Output 343e1ed2bfc5eccf40c120e58c4e19e2299a7ef36e0fa31ae9ef7a6fb0d2060e:0

value
102513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fdaf499c5b37edfc0561986a38f98b671f359ae OP_EQUAL
address
3KBTHUaGLhRW7kvQkN2HBPo2KuAxWaYuaw
transaction
343e1ed2bfc5eccf40c120e58c4e19e2299a7ef36e0fa31ae9ef7a6fb0d2060e
confirmations
57324
spent
true